Duke Adrian rose from his seat and stroked Daniel’s head.

“You’re a good brother.”

“I’m not a good brother. I’m trying to be, though.”

“No, you’re already a good brother.”

“…….”

“I’ll talk to Rose a little more. So don’t worry.”

“Yes.”

Daniel’s eyes welled up, but he didn’t cry.

He looked relieved, having poured out all his thoughts, and was about to leave the office. Then he turned back and approached Duke Adrian again.

“Father, do you remember what I said during the carriage accident last time? Prince Joshua and Rose told me to be careful of carriage accidents.”

“Yes.”

“Saying to be careful of accidents is something you can say, but after experiencing this incident, it feels even stranger. Why did both of them only give me that advice? Was it a coincidence?”

“I wonder.”

“Considering that the two of them worked together to resolve the Empress’s matter this time, it’s even stranger. Could the two of them have known each other before?”

Daniel chuckled as if he found it ridiculous himself.

“It’s a ridiculous assumption. How would Rose even meet Prince Joshua? He’s someone even we have difficulty meeting.”

“That’s true.”

Daniel saw the serious look on Duke Adrian’s face and bowed.

“Then I’ll be going.”

“Alright.”

Left alone, Duke Adrian recalled the assumption he had vaguely thought of earlier.

‘Knowing the future…’

Could that really be possible?

After pondering for a while, he headed to the study without telling anyone. He looked through various magic books, but being ignorant of magic, he couldn’t understand anything.

If he sought advice from Celine, he might find a clue.

‘Not yet.’

He couldn’t reveal uncertain facts to others. It wasn’t good for the two young children to receive public attention and suspicion based on uncertain assumptions.

After all, he was Rosette’s father and Joshua’s teacher. He had a duty to protect the two children.

‘I’ll investigate slowly on my own.’

For the sake of the two children, he decided to take a step back for now.

Duke Adrian did not doubt Rosette and Joshua.

They were his beloved daughter and disciple. He didn’t think the two would harm him, let alone Adrian.

‘If they really know the future, and that’s why they keep jumping into dangerous situations…’

Instead of letting the children protect Adrian, Adrian had to protect them.

[English Translation] Rosette yearned for her family's love, only to be exploited and ultimately forced to kill Duke Adrian, the empire's greatest swordsman. But in his final moments, Prince Joshua's tears sparked a revelation, sending Rosette back in time with a burning resolve: to escape her toxic family. Fate, however, has other plans. Offered refuge by the very man she was forced to kill, Rosette finds herself embraced by a warm, loving family. Now, armed with newfound purpose and powerful magic, she vows to protect them from the darkness that looms. But a figure from the past emerges, threatening to shatter her newfound happiness and demanding a terrible price. Can Rosette defy destiny and shield her loved ones, or will the sins of her past consume her future?
